Swissmedic: Portal Update

Swissmedic has updated its medicinal products' portal, introducing a new process for ordering GxP certificates and granting direct access to all pre-registered company administrators. However, Swissmedic acknowledged the absence of a new onboarding process for companies or administrators as a known issue.

New Features:

  • All pre-registered company administrators now have direct access to the Swissmedic Portal.
  • Company administrators can authorize their users to access and use the Swissmedic Portal through the eIAM delegated management application.
  • Within the Establishment Licenses context page, we have enabled the "Certificate" button. Clicking this button will open the order assistant, guiding you step by step through the GxP certificate ordering process. This means, that the existing process using MLP/eGov-Portal to order GxP certificates is replaced, starting now.
